2. The Flight Deck: Mechanics Behind the Sky
The core of Aviator is deceptively simple: a plane takes off and its multiplier grows until it crashes or until you decide to cash out. The underlying engine is a provably fair system that mixes the operator’s seed with random data from the first three players in each round, ensuring that no single player can influence outcomes.
You place your bet, watch the multiplier tick upward, then decide whether to hit cash out before the plane disappears into the clouds. If you’re right, your bet multiplies; if not, you lose everything you wagered for that round.
- Provably fair cryptographic system guarantees transparency.
- Two simultaneous bets possible – one for safety, one for risk.
- Auto‑cash‑out allows pre‑set safety nets.

5. Auto Cash‑Out: The Silent Co‑Pilot
An auto‑cash‑out feature is like having a co‑pilot that pulls you away just before the plane leaves the runway. You set a multiplier threshold—say, 1.8x—and every time your bet reaches that level it automatically sells out.
This tool is especially handy during quick sessions where you can’t afford to monitor every second manually. It also forces discipline by preventing emotional last‑minute cash outs when the multiplier is soaring.
- Set auto‑cash‑out early to lock in small gains.
- Use it as an exit strategy when you’re not confident about manual timing.
- Avoid setting too high thresholds—most crashes happen before hitting extreme multipliers during short play.
By combining auto‑cash‑out with manual timing on your “wild” bet, you create a balanced risk profile that works best for rapid gameplay.
